The Entoleter Insect Destroyer, offered by Uğur Promilling, is a high-speed solution for eliminating larvae and insects within flour milling applications. This equipment employs centrifugal force to rupture insect eggs, preventing infestation and preserving flour purity. Ideal for producing all-purpose, whole wheat, and specialty flours, it is commonly integrated at critical points such as flour silo entries or packaging stages. Operating continuously, it supports large-scale flour mills with significant throughput demands. Constructed with durable materials for food-grade environments, it integrates seamlessly with milling processes and is designed for easy maintenance. Optional PLC control enhances automation within existing systems.
